Hull Speed

The theoretical displacement-mode speed limit — determined by waterline length, not engine or sail power.

7.1 kts
A displacement hull pushes a bow wave whose speed is limited by the waterline length. With a waterline of 28.2′, the Pearson 34 2 tops out around 7.1 knots in displacement mode — after that, the bow wave outruns the hull and resistance climbs steeply.
1.34 × √28.2′ LWL = 7.1 kts

Motion & Offshore Suitability

Two ratios that matter most when you're planning passages — how the boat feels in a seaway, and whether the hull geometry is suitable for open ocean.

Comfort Ratio
23.5
Acceptable coastal comfort — fine for weekends, notice the chop offshore.
Under 20 — Snappy, racing motion
20–30 — Acceptable coastal
30–40 — Good offshore comfort
Over 40 — Very comfortable offshore
Capsize Screening Formula
2.02
Above the 2.0 offshore threshold — best suited for coastal and protected waters.
Under 2.0 — Acceptable for offshore
Over 2.0 — Coastal / protected waters
